Whey Protein

Whey protein is the protein from whey, the watery part of milk that separates from the curds when making cheese. It is frequently used as a protein supplement.

Whey protein may improve the nutrition content of the diet and likewise have effects on the immune system.

Individuals commonly utilize whey protein for improving athletic efficiency and increasing strength. Whey protein is likewise utilized for asthma, diabetes, weight reduction, and numerous other conditions, but there is no good clinical evidence to support the majority of these usages. (2 ).

Composition

The protein in cow’s milk is around 20% whey and 80% casein. The protein in human milk is around 60% whey and 40% casein. The protein fraction in whey makes up approximately 10% of the total dry solids in whey. This protein is usually a mix of beta-lactoglobulin (~ 65%), alpha-lactalbumin (~ 25%), bovine serum albumin (~ 8%) (see also serum albumin), and immunoglobulins.the third biggest fragment of whey protein isolate stemmed from sweet whey is glycomacropeptide, which is technically not a protein. These are soluble in their native forms, independent of ph. (4 ).

Systems of action

Recently, numerous research studies have found that taking in whey prior to or with a meal considerably reduced postprandial glycemia and enhanced the insulin response. A number of systems have been proposed to explain how whey has the ability to apply these impacts. However, the response most likely includes several, interconnected pathways.

Moa 1: bioactive peptides from food digestion or hydrolyzed whey activate incretin hormone release. Moa 2: quick food digestion of whey leads to a quick rise in amino acids (bcaas, in particular), which leads to increased insulin release. Moa 3: amino acids and peptides from hydrolyzed (in vitro hydrolysis from pepsin or trypsin or in vivo digestion) whey hinder dpp-iv to stop destruction of gip and glp-1. Moa = mechanism of action.

Early investigative work by nilsson et al. Analyzing the insulinotropic impact of milk, and whey specifically, attributed the benefits to the bioactive peptides or amino acids. In healthy subjects, both milk and whey-based test meals resulted in lower postprandial glucose areas under the curve (aucs) than a white bread reference meal (-62 and -57%, respectively). However, a whey meal caused significantly greater aucs for insulin (90%) and stomach inhibitory peptide (gip, 54%). The postprandial amino acid reaction was likewise more considerable for the whey meal, that included the highest incremental rise in bcaas – known stimulators of insulin secretion.

Nilsson et al. Proposed that intestinal digestion of whey results in bioactive peptides or particular amino acids, activating the release of incretin hormonal agents. However, it was kept in mind that the insulinotropic result of whey could not be because of the incretin system alone. The authors hypothesized that the postprandial increased insulin response with whey protein could be credited to a more fast food digestion of whey protein than casein. (5 ).

Whey protein might reduce blood pressure

Abnormally high blood pressure (hypertension) is among the leading threat elements for cardiovascular disease.

Various studies have actually linked the consumption of dairy items with minimized blood pressure.

This effect has been credited to a household of bioactive peptides in dairy, so-called angiotensin-converting-enzyme inhibitors (ace-inhibitors).

In whey proteins, the ace-inhibitors are called lactokinins. Numerous animal research studies have shown their useful impacts on high blood pressure.

A restricted number of human research studies have actually examined the effect of whey proteins on high blood pressure, and numerous experts think about the proof to be inconclusive.

One research study in overweight people showed that whey protein supplements, 54 g/day for 12 weeks, lowered systolic high blood pressure by 4%. Other milk proteins (casein) had comparable effects.

This is supported by another research study that discovered considerable results when participants were given whey protein concentrate (22 g/day) for 6 weeks.

Nevertheless, high blood pressure decreased just in those that had high or slightly raised blood pressure to begin with.

No substantial effects on blood pressure were spotted in a study that utilized much lower quantities of wey protein (less than 3.25 g/day) mixed in a milk drink.

Summary

Whey proteins might decrease high blood pressure in people with elevated high blood pressure. This is because of boactive peptides called lactokinins.

Whey protein might boost the body’s antioxidant defenses

Antioxidants are substances that act against oxidation in the body. This means they reduce oxidative tension and lower the danger of numerous chronic illness.

One of the most important anti-oxidants in people is glutathione. Unlike a lot of anti-oxidants, which you receive from your diet, glutathione is produced by your body.

In the body, glutathione production depends upon the supply of numerous amino acids, such as cysteine, which is sometimes of restricted supply.

For this reason, high cysteine foods, such as whey protein, may boost the body’s natural antioxidant defenses.

A variety of studies in both humans and rodents have actually discovered that whey proteins might lower oxidative tension and increase levels of glutathione.

Summary

Whey protein supplementation might enhance the body’s antioxidant defenses by promoting the formation of glutathione, among the body’s main anti-oxidants.

Interactions

Levodopainteraction score: significant do not take this combination. Whey protein might reduce how much levodopa the body absorbs. By reducing just how much levodopa the body takes in, whey protein may decrease the efficiency of levodopa. Do not take whey protein and levodopa at the same time.

Albendazoleinteraction ranking: moderate beware with this combination. Talk with your health provider. Whey protein can reduce how much albendazole the body absorbs. Taking whey protein and albendazole at the same time can decrease the efficiency of albendazole. Do not take whey protein while taking albendazole.

Alendronate (fosamax) interaction score: moderate beware with this combination. Talk with your health service provider. Whey protein can reduce just how much alendronate (fosamax) the body takes in. Taking whey protein and alendronate (fosamax) at the same time can decrease the efficiency of alendronate (fosamax). Do not take whey protein within 2 hours of taking alendronate (fosamax).

Antibiotics (quinolone prescription antibiotics) interaction score: moderate be cautious with this combination. Talk with your health supplier. Whey protein might reduce just how much antibiotic the body absorbs. Taking whey protein along with some antibiotics may decrease the efficiency of some antibiotics. To prevent this interaction take whey protein supplements a minimum of one hour after antibiotics.

A few of these antibiotics that may connect with whey protein include ciprofloxacin (cipro), enoxacin (penetrex), norfloxacin (chibroxin, noroxin), sparfloxacin (zagam), trovafloxacin (trovan), and grepafloxacin (raxar).

Prescription antibiotics (tetracycline prescription antibiotics) interaction score: moderate be cautious with this combination. Talk with your health provider. Whey protein consists of calcium. The calcium in whey protein can connect to tetracyclines in the stomach. This reduces the amount of tetracyclines that can be absorbed. Taking calcium with tetracyclines might reduce the effectiveness of tetracyclines. To prevent this interaction, take whey protein 2 hours before or four hours after taking tetracyclines.

Some tetracyclines consist of demeclocycline (declomycin), minocycline (minocin), and tetracycline (achromycin). (11 ).

Conclusions

In summary, the consumption of 25 g of whey protein after an evening bout of resistance workout tended to improve whole body internet protein balance over 10 h of overnight healing compared to a rested control, and was moderately helpful versus an isocaloric carbohydrate post-exercise supplement. Taking in an additional 25 g of whey protein in the morning after exercise contributed to the upkeep of a higher whole body protein balance over the 24 h recovery period compared to a rested control and carbohydrate supplementation. The higher whole body anabolism with whey protein supplementation was also associated with enhanced healing workout efficiency after an extreme bout of resistance workout. Jointly, our data recommend that resistance-trained people may benefit from protein supplements after a night bout of resistance workout along with the following morning to attenuate over night fasted-state protein losses and enhance workout efficiency healing.
